  • Some cars seem like they were only launched yesterday - for us, that car is the A-Class which has been on our roads since 2018. Of course, a few years on, it's time for an update so join us for an in-depth look at the recently refreshed model.
    The entire compact car range has been getting updated with the new technology we've seen here so make sure to stay tuned to see the facelifted B-Class, CLA, GLA and GLB when they arrive in the UK.

      @LandLAutomotive  11 месяцев назад

      The A-Class has been removed from sale in the US; the last models available were the 2022 model year. The CLA coupé will continue to be sold alongside the GLA and both those models have had the same tech and interior updates as this new A-Class.
      From what I've read, the first refreshed CLA coupés should be arriving in the US this year.

      @LandLAutomotive  Год назад +2

      A lot of that price jump is because it launched in in two equipment levels in 2020 before the "entry level" was dropped from the UK in 2021. Spec for spec (Plus trim) it has increased incrementally and then again with the facelift up from £57,000 in late 2020.
